Section 50 and 51 of the 1999 Constitution: Staff of the National Assembly

National Assembly

The 1999 Constitution

Section 50 (1)(a)

There shall be:-
a President and a Deputy President of the Senate, who shall be elected by the members of that House from among themselves; and

(The National Assembly will consist of a President and Deputy President of the Senate and they shall be elected by the members of the House from among themselves.)


Section 50 (1)(b)

a Speaker and a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ives, who shall be elected by the members of that House from among themselves.

(The National Assembly shall consist of a Speaker and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ives and such people shall be elected by the members of that House from among themselves.)


Section 50 (2)

The President or Deputy President of the Senate or the Speaker or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ives shall vacate his office

(The President or Deputy President of the Senate and the Speaker or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ives shall leave their offices if one of the following circumstances occur; )


Section 50 (2)(a)

if he ceases to be a member of the Senate or of the House of Representatives, as the case may be, otherwise than by reason of a dissolution of the Senate or the House of Representatives; or

(If such a person stops being a member of the Senate or House as the case may be, other than by a dissolution of the Senate or House of Representatives.)


Section 50 (2)(b)

when the House of which he was a member first sits after any dissolution of that House; or

(When the House of which he was a member of that was dissolved, first sits after such dissolution.)


Section 50 (2)(c)

if he is removed from office by a resolution of the Senate or of the House of Representatives, as the case may be, by the votes of not less than two-thirds majority of the members of that House.

(If such person is voted out of office by not less than two-third’s majority by a resolution of members of the Senate or House of Representatives, as the case may be.)


Section 51

There shall be a Clerk to the National Assembly and such other staff as may be prescribed by an Act of the National Assembly, and the method of appointment of the Clerk and other staff of the National Assembly shall be as prescribed by that tab

(The National Assembly shall have a Clerk and other staffs as the Act of the National Assembly may create for its proper function. The method of appointment of the Clerk and other staff is provided for in the Act of the National Assembly.)
